Cape Creeper –
Unboxed mine and it come in a nice rigid case. It seems hearty and the plastic should stand to light abuse. Mine actually had some rattles straight out of the case. I was concerned it might short something out but I put a wire on it and hit the button while around a nut and bolt. Directions say only hold for a few seconds. 15-25 seconds is more like it. Just so everyone knows, it heats up only in the area of the “coiled wire. My fan ran quiet and strong but that rattle inside spooked me and I did not want to be stuck with it beyond the return window. I feel it is a decent tool and I simply got one with poor quality control. Maybe they will come out with a new version/design.
